Grape Chutney Baked Brie
By Kankana Saxena, Food Blogger: www.playfulcooking.com

Baked Brie is sure to be a crowd pleaser no matter the season, but adding grapes and honey for a sweet twist makes it all the more flavorful.

 

Prep Time: 5 min

Cook Time: 28 min

Total Time: 33 min

 

Serves: 4-6

 

Ingredients:

– 12 oz Divine Flavor table grapes

– 1 tsp oil

– ½ tsp black mustard seeds

– ½ tsp fennel seeds

– 1 dry red chili

– ½ tsp salt

– 1 tsp sugar

– 1 tsp paprika

– ½ tsp cumin powder

– 1 tsp fennel powder

– ¼ cup toasted walnuts

– 8 oz brie cheese

– 1 tbsp honey

 

Instructions:

  1. Place a heavy bottom pan on medium heat and drizzle the olive oil over it. Once the oil heats up, carefully drop the whole spices into the pan along with the dry red chili. It may splatter – be careful! After a few seconds, drop in the grapes and sprinkle with salt and sugar. Stir and cook for 3 minutes.
  2. Sprinkle the cumin powder, fennel powder, and paprika. Stir and cook 5 more minutes, or until the grapes are soft and can be easily crushed. Add more sugar to taste.
  3. Crush the grapes lightly and take the pan off the heat. Let cool.
  4. Preheat oven to 375 degrees.
  5. Place the brie on an ovenproof pan or skillet. Drizzle honey and spread some of the grape chutney on top. Then top with toasted walnuts and bake 20 minutes.
  6. Serve immediately with crackers, remaining chutney, and walnuts.
